mirror of
				https://github.com/bytecodealliance/wasm-micro-runtime.git
				synced 2025-10-31 13:17:31 +00:00 
			
		
		
		
	 7191ecf880
			
		
	
	
		7191ecf880
		
			
		
	
	
	
	
		
			
			Customize clang-format coding styles for C source files based on Mozilla template.
To check whether the C source codes are well formatted:
``` bash
$ cd ${wamr-root}
$ clang-format --Werror --dry-run --style=file path/to/file
```
To format the C source codes in place
``` bash
$ cd ${wamr_root}
$ clang-format -i --style=file path/to/file
```
Signed-off-by: Wenyong Huang <wenyong.huang@intel.com>
		
	
			
		
			
				
	
	
		
			17 lines
		
	
	
		
			606 B
		
	
	
	
		
			YAML
		
	
	
	
	
	
			
		
		
	
	
			17 lines
		
	
	
		
			606 B
		
	
	
	
		
			YAML
		
	
	
	
	
	
| # refer to https://clang.llvm.org/extra/clang-tidy/checks/list.html
 | |
| 
 | |
| Checks:  '-*, readability-identifier-naming, clang-analyzer-core.*,'
 | |
| WarningsAsErrors:    '-*'
 | |
| HeaderFilterRegex:   ''
 | |
| FormatStyle:         file
 | |
| InheritParentConfig: false
 | |
| AnalyzeTemporaryDtors: false
 | |
| User:                wamr
 | |
| CheckOptions:
 | |
|   - key:             readability-identifier-naming.VariableCase
 | |
|     value:           lower_case
 | |
|   - key:             readability-identifier-naming.ParameterCase
 | |
|     value:           lower_case
 | |
|   - key:             readability-identifier-naming.MacroDefinitionCase
 | |
|     value:           UPPER_CASE
 |